    As much as I am a buy American and have 3 RMRs, on a pistol it's hard to beat Holosun 507 and 509 Optics. All of mine have the Primary Arms Vulcan reticle (250 MOA circle and center Chevron) which I really like.

    I'm an old dude Tried to use red dots on pistols 3 different times. Just could never do it. The Vulcan reticle is amazing. Even new shooters find the Chevron very quickly. The giant circle makes centering the Chevron subconscious and fast. It's also a great under night vision and looks like a heads up display.
